اطلاعیه

Collapse
No announcement yet.

سیستم کنترل ربات های مسیر یاب

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    سیستم کنترل ربات های مسیر یاب

    سلام دوستان ...
    میدونم PID چیه ... میشه حالا شما ها بگید چه جوری میشه نوشت اینو ؟؟ مثلا تو c و محیط code vision چی جوری مینویسن ؟؟
    ممنون !

    #2
    پاسخ : سیستم کنترل ربات های مسیر یاب

    آقا ما وقتی شنیدیم که در این دنیا مفهومی به نام pid وجود داره فکر کردم که چشمه آب حیات - اکسیر جوانی - ... رو یافتم . آخه من الکترنیک تو دانشگاه نخوندم . به هر حال یک کتاب pdf فارسی بود زود دانلودش کردم و شش دنگ حواس جمع و ... شروع کردم به خوندن کتاب آقا فصل اول که تاریخچه پیدایش سیستم کنترل بود واقعا مهشر بود . راجب حقه بازی های کلیسا و معبد و دیر و ... بود می خواستم از خوشحال خودمو بکشتم
    تا رسیدیم به فصل دوم شروع کرد به معادلات لاپلاس خوب من عاشق ریاضیاتم خوب میدونستم چی میگه و می خواد مارو کجا ببره .
    فصل سوم کتاب اگار بحث یکم جدی شد و معادلات لاپلاس رو شرح داد.
    فصل چهارم کتاب یکم تغییر رو احساس کردم چون تشکیل معادله لاپلاس رو شرح میداد oo:
    فصل 5 باز معادلات لاپلاس رو باز کرد oo:
    فصل 6 معادلات لاپلاس :eek:
    فصل 7 معادلات لاپلاس :eek:
    فصل 8 معادلات لاپلاس :eek:
    فصل 9 معادلات لاپلاس :cry2:
    ..
    فصل 120 معادلات لاپلاس :cry2:



    مسخره بازی به خدا
    تا اونجایی که من میدونم لاپلاس اومده معادلات دیفرانسیل خطی معمولی رو با یک روش ساده حل میکنه خوب اگه ما بخوایم معدلات دیفرانسیل رو مستقیم حل کنیم کیو باید ببینیم ؟ آقا اصلا من میخوام معادله دیفرانسیل رو با روش های عددی حل کنم به سیستم کنترل خطی چه مربوطه ؟



    من هم دنبال یک مثال عملی میگشتم که فقط با کنترل pid بشه کنترلش کرد .
    مثلا آسانسور رو مثال میزنن من مگم آخه کجای آسانسور ما نیاز به pid داریم
    برا کجاش سه تا معادله بنویسیم خود مساله که خیلی راحت قابل حله .


    حالا شما می خوای روباتت رو با pid کنترل کنی :NO: شما بگو من یک الگوریتم ساده پیدا کنم بعد شما بگو که این درست نیشت و به این علت فقط باید با pid کنترل بشه
    تنها موردي كه همه آدما يقين دارن خدا در حقش زیاد لطف کرده
    داشتن عقله زيادتر از دیگر آدم ها است

    دیدگاه


      #3
      پاسخ : سیستم کنترل ربات های مسیر یاب

      دوست عزیز ..
      با مقایسه به این نتیجه رسیدم که رباتی که با PID نوشته میشه و رباتای دیگه که بدون آن مینویسن خیلی فرق دارن تو سرعت و از خط خارج شدن ؟
      حالا هر کی هرچی میدونه بریزه اینجا ...
      از PID چیه تا درآوردن ضرایب PID |( با ژنتیک میگن سه سوته ! نمیدونم والا ) تا ...

      دیدگاه


        #4
        پاسخ : سیستم کنترل ربات های مسیر یاب

        منم علاقمندم بدونم چطوری می نویسند اگه دوستان منت بگذارند توضیح عملی بدند خیلی ممنون می شم
        گویند سنگ لعل شود در مقام صبر اری شود ولی به خون جگر شود
        همیشه آخر همه چیز خوبه، اگر هم هنوز خوب نشده پس هنوز آخرش نشده(چارلی چاپلین)

        دیدگاه


          #5
          پاسخ : سیستم کنترل ربات های مسیر یاب

          یک چیزای شنیدم در موردش
          دوستان میشه یک کم مسعله رو ساده تر بگید ما هم بفهمیم این سیستم عملکردش چه جوریه!؟
          ....

          دیدگاه


            #6
            پاسخ : سیستم کنترل ربات های مسیر یاب

            اگر کمی توی اینترنت جستجو کنید مثال ها و داده های زیادی پیدا می کنید ولی به زبان اصلی
            یک PDF خوب در این زمینه هست که اتفاقا برای کنترل موتور و به زبان C نوشته شده است که می توانید ازآن ایده بگیرید.

            www.dprg.org/tutorials/2003-10a/motorcontrol.pdf

            دیدگاه


              #7
              پاسخ : سیستم کنترل ربات های مسیر یاب

              نوشته اصلی توسط jalal gilani
              اگر کمی توی اینترنت جستجو کنید مثال ها و داده های زیادی پیدا می کنید ولی به زبان اصلی
              یک PDF خوب در این زمینه هست که اتفاقا برای کنترل موتور و به زبان C نوشته شده است که می توانید ازآن ایده بگیرید.

              www.dprg.org/tutorials/2003-10a/motorcontrol.pdf
              ممنون ! متوجه هستم .. منم خیلی گشتم
              حالا این ضرایب و اینا چه جوریه داستانش ؟؟ مثلا تو مسیریاب اصلا به چه دردی میخوره ؟!

              دیدگاه


                #8
                پاسخ : سیستم کنترل ربات های مسیر یاب

                سلام خدمت اساتید.
                بحث کنترل کلا در فضای لاپلاس راحت تر و بهتره و دقیق تره.
                ولی برای برنامه نویسی اون تو c و هر زبان دیگه ای نیازمند بلد بودن درسی به نام محاسبات عددیه و باید بتونیم که این معادلات رو به شکل عددی (جمع ضرب تفریق تقسیم) بیان نمود. ولی در مورد ربات و بیشتر سیستم ها با pi قضیه حل میشه و حتی p هم برای ربات تعقیب خط مناسبه . شما برای ربات یه خورده رفتار موتورو دینامیکی کنی و با یک کنترلر p(تناسبی) بذاری به نتیجه عالی میرسی
                آنکس که بداند و بداند که بداند /، اسب شرف از گنبد گردون بجهاند
                آنکس که بداند و نداند که بداند / ، بيدارش نماييد که بسي خفته نماند
                آنکس که نداند و بداند که نداند / ، لنگان خرک خويش به مقصد برساند
                آنکس که نداند و نداند که نداند / ، در جهل مرکب ابدالدهر بماند

                دیدگاه


                  #9
                  پاسخ : سیستم کنترل ربات های مسیر یاب

                  نوشته اصلی توسط king_of_hearts90
                  سلام خدمت اساتید.
                  بحث کنترل کلا در فضای لاپلاس راحت تر و بهتره و دقیق تره.
                  ولی برای برنامه نویسی اون تو c و هر زبان دیگه ای نیازمند بلد بودن درسی به نام محاسبات عددیه و باید بتونیم که این معادلات رو به شکل عددی (جمع ضرب تفریق تقسیم) بیان نمود. ولی در مورد ربات و بیشتر سیستم ها با pi قضیه حل میشه و حتی p هم برای ربات تعقیب خط مناسبه . شما برای ربات یه خورده رفتار موتورو دینامیکی کنی و با یک کنترلر p(تناسبی) بذاری به نتیجه عالی میرسی
                  استاد مشکل اینه که ما محاسبات عددی بلد نیستیم ؟!
                  دانلود جزوه محاسبات عددی برای کلیه رشته های مهندسی
                  در علوم مهندسی همیشه یک مسئله وقتی به نتیجه می رسد که جواب نهایی آن به صورت یک عدد درست باشد ولی همین مورد در بسیاری از مسائل مشکلاتی را به وجود می آورد که از لحاظ اقتصادی مقرون به صرفه نیست، یا اینکه روش تحلیلی مستقلی را برای آن نمی توان ابلاغ کرد و یا از نظر زمانی رسیدن به آن اعداد بسیار طاقت فرسا و زمان بر است، لذا اینجاست که سر و کله محاسبات عددی پیدا می شود .
                  جزوه ای که برای شما قرار می دهیم تنها جزوه تایپ شده و قابل قبول از نظر کامل بودن و قابل فهم بودن است که در اینترنت یافت می شود و بعد از جستجو های فراوان این جزوه بسیار عالی را برای شما فراهم کردیم . جزوه محاسبات عددی توسط استاد محمود پری پور نوشته شده و در 63 صفحه بسیار زیبا و تایپ شده آماده گشته است . همچنین در پایان این جزوه چندین نمونه سوال برای شما طراحی شده است .
                  مباحثی که در جزوه محاسبات عددی مطالعه خواهید کرد :
                  فصل اول : خطاها
                  فصل دوم : حل عددی دستگاه های معادلات خطی وغیرخطی
                  - روشهای مستقیم
                  - روشهای تکراری
                  فصل سوم: حل عددی معادله f (x) =0
                  - روش دو بخشی (تنصیف یا نصف کردن)
                  - روش نابجایی
                  - روش نیوتن
                  - روش سکانت
                  - حل دستگاه معادلات غیر خطی
                  فصل چهارم: درون یابی و برازش منحنی
                  - درون یابی
                  - برازش منحنی
                  فصل پنجم: محاسبه عددی مشتق و انتگرال
                  - مشتق گیری عددی
                  - روش نیوتن – کاتس: باز و بسته
                  - روش گاوس
                  فصل ششم: حل عددی معادلات دیفرانسیل
                  - روش تیلور
                  - روش اویلر
                  - روش رونگه ‐ کوتا
                  توجه : دو فونت در کنار کتاب است که باید نصب نمایید . در غیر اینصورت جزوه به خوبی نمایش پیدا نمی کند



                  ---------------------------------------------------
                  حجم فایل: 329KB
                  ---------------------------------------------------
                  ---------------------------------------------------
                  دانلود فایل
                  ---------------------------------------------------

                  پسورد:www.techno-electro.com

                  ----------------------------------------------------
                  خب حالا بلدیم .
                  دوستان لطفا بگید بابا اگه بخوایم مشتق و انتگرالو هم دخیل کنیم چه باید کرد ؟!

                  دیدگاه


                    #10
                    پاسخ : سیستم کنترل ربات های مسیر یاب

                    خب حالا با یکی از روش های خوب و ساده و نسبتا دقیق انتگرال رو میگیریم.
                    دقت کنید که حداقل 4 نمونه از فیدبک باید به عنوان ورودی مورد استفاده قرار بگیره.
                    دوستان و اساتید دیگه لطفا تو این تاپیک کمک کنن که من اطلاعاتم فقط در حد یک پروژه کنترل موتور می باشد .
                    آنکس که بداند و بداند که بداند /، اسب شرف از گنبد گردون بجهاند
                    آنکس که بداند و نداند که بداند / ، بيدارش نماييد که بسي خفته نماند
                    آنکس که نداند و بداند که نداند / ، لنگان خرک خويش به مقصد برساند
                    آنکس که نداند و نداند که نداند / ، در جهل مرکب ابدالدهر بماند

                    دیدگاه


                      #11
                      پاسخ : سیستم کنترل ربات های مسیر یاب

                      جناب DRT نمیدونم مثال را مطالعه فرمودید یا خیر در کل در این مثال روش انتگرال گیری و مشتق گیری بصورت محاسبات عددی و در واحد زمان ارایه شده است
                      برای مقدار ضریب ها هیچ فرمولی وجود ندارد پیدا کردن این ضرایب را در سیستم های PID به نام TUNING می شناسند که بصورت تجربی و با اندازه گیری به دست خواهد آمد چون در هر سیستم با سیستم دیگر متفاوت است.

                      دیدگاه


                        #12
                        پاسخ : سیستم کنترل ربات های مسیر یاب

                        نوشته اصلی توسط jalal gilani
                        جناب DRT نمیدونم مثال را مطالعه فرمودید یا خیر در کل در این مثال روش انتگرال گیری و مشتق گیری بصورت محاسبات عددی و در واحد زمان ارایه شده است
                        برای مقدار ضریب ها هیچ فرمولی وجود ندارد پیدا کردن این ضرایب را در سیستم های PID به نام TUNING می شناسند که بصورت تجربی و با اندازه گیری به دست خواهد آمد چون در هر سیستم با سیستم دیگر متفاوت است.
                        دوست عزیز پس چه جوری دوستان بدست میارن ؟!
                        میگن با ژنتیک !

                        دیدگاه


                          #13
                          پاسخ : سیستم کنترل ربات های مسیر یاب

                          والا من نمیدونم دیگر دوستان چطور به دست می آورند ولی تنها راهی که برای این ضرایب وجود دارد بدست آوردن آن با سعی خطاست مگر اینکه پارامتر های کامل سیستم بصورت عدد در اختیار باشند از قبیل ضرایب استکاک ، لختی سیستم و ... که معولا چنین چیزی وجود ندارداین روش اختراع بنده نیست تمام سیستم های PID احتیاج به Tunning دارند.

                          دیدگاه


                            #14
                            پاسخ : سیستم کنترل ربات های مسیر یاب

                            نوشته اصلی توسط jalal gilani
                            والا من نمیدونم دیگر دوستان چطور به دست می آورند ولی تنها راهی که برای این ضرایب وجود دارد بدست آوردن آن با سعی خطاست مگر اینکه پارامتر های کامل سیستم بصورت عدد در اختیار باشند از قبیل ضرایب استکاک ، لختی سیستم و ... که معولا چنین چیزی وجود ندارداین روش اختراع بنده نیست تمام سیستم های PID احتیاج به Tunning دارند.
                            ما که هر جا تایپیک pid زدیم ج نگرفتیم

                            دیدگاه


                              #15
                              پاسخ : سیستم کنترل ربات های مسیر یاب

                              تا به حال سعی در انجامش کردید و جواب نگرفتید ؟

                              دیدگاه

                              لطفا صبر کنید...
                              X